4

Как я могу узнать, установлена ли виртуальная машина Java на моей Windows 7?

5 ответов5

7

Откройте командную строку и введите следующее:

java -version

Это должно дать вам версию JRE, которую вы установили, что-то вроде:

java version "1.6.0_24"
Java(TM) SE Runtime Environment (build 1.6.0_24-b07)

Если это не помогло, вы также можете проверить, установлена ли у вас какая-либо JRE. Расположение по умолчанию обычно находится в ${HOME_DIR}\Program Files\Java\ , где ${HOME_DIR} обычно это C:\

5

Run->cmd тип java -version .
Если вы получили жалобу на неизвестную команду, то Java не установлена.

1

@ Yahor10 прав. Вы можете сначала ввести java а затем java -version в командной строке. Если это сработает, вы увидите, что JRE установлен и находится на вашем пути.

Но если это не в пути, вы не будете знать это. Поэтому я предпочитаю открыть regedit и перейти к ключу H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ft . Если этот ключ не существует, Java не устанавливается. Если существует, Java обычно устанавливается. Предыдущие версии java создавали запись реестра, в которой указывался путь, где установлена java. Я только что проверил на моей Win7, java1.6-27 и увидел, что такой записи не существует.

Другой способ - попасть в ControlPanel/Programs и проверить там.

0

Либо проверьте java -version в командной строке, посмотрите список установленных программ (панель управления), проверьте, содержит ли Program Files папку с именем Java или посмотрите, есть ли переменная среды с именем JAVA_HOME .

Если ни то, ни другое не является правдой, существует высокая вероятность того, что у вас не установлены JRE или JDK, но это все еще не ясно. AFAIK Windows 7 не содержит JRE как таковую, поэтому если у вас чистая система, скорее всего, у вас еще нет JRE.

0

Другой способ проверить это онлайн.

http://www.inaplex.com/Products/jvmCheck.aspx или

http://javatester.org/version.html

Он работает в моей системе, но я не очень уверен в его точности.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.